
Six of the 47 career Platinums won by this Oregon winery have been for Cabernet Franc, which makes Cecil Zerba’s 1,300-foot elevation Jon Cockburn Ranch Vineyard one of the Northwest’s premier sites for a grape more celebrated in the Loire Valley than Bordeaux. Brent Roberts, a graduate of Washington State University’s wine program, began at Zerba Cellars in 2014, and this is the fourth Platinum for a wine that Franc has played a role in. Understated aromas of cinnamon, red currant, pumice and sweet herbs lead to ripe red berries, dried Lucy Glo apple chips and Italian herbs — all within a suave structure. Qualifying award: Pacific Northwest (gold)
Rating: Platinum • 90 points
Production: 323 cases
Alcohol: 14.9%
